DEEC! Young winger Turgott pens new Hammers deal

Young West Ham winger Blair Turgott couldn't have had a better day yesterday, as he put pen to paper on a new two year contract at the Boleyn Ground, before notching a fantastic hat trick for a West Ham XI against an experienced QPR XI made up of Premier League stars such as Adel Taarabt and Jamie Mackie.

The Hammers now have tied the livewire 18 year old at the club till 2015, and he was visibly delighted to sign the deal

"It's going well at the moment and that's a great way to celebrate a new deal and now I've really got to push on from here and hopefully show the management staff what type of player I am."

Turgott was also delighted with his first ever goals at the Boleyn Ground

"It's good to get my first goals here and hopefully the first of many- I scored two against Dagenham last season but obviously a hat trick is even sweeter. It's always good to play alongside the senior boys and get that experience and QPR had a few senior players out there which is always good, as you can measure yourself up against them. Ultimately it's about me, showing what I can do and what I'm about."
